I have an 11 year old son, and 4 of his molars are loose. I don't remember losing mine therefore don't know if it's normal.

yes, kids lose there 1 year and 2 year molars. (so they lose the 1st 2 rows, or 8 molars all together.) the 6 year and 12 year ones they have forever.
